Meguiar's #80
Werkstatt Prime Acrylic
Werkstatt AJT
My paint still felt glass smooth after a wash so I didn't need to clay. I had some light scratches on my finish so I decided to polish first with Meguiar's #80 and a light cutting pad using my PC. After the #80 I applied Prime and followed that with AJT
The appearance was glossy, highly reflective and wet; it really made my metallic flake pop. The only question mark for me is durability. I've always been a skeptic of spray waxes/sealants and their durability though I've read good things about AJT so I have high expectations.
This detail was actually done a couple of months ago and the Werkstatt is holding up well. After a few washes, water is still beading and the gloss is still excellent.
